Chronicles of Mugla

Göcek (ancient Kalymna) was a minor Lycian port and later a fishing village; its modern identity began in the 1980s when the Turkish government developed it as a yachting destination. The narrow streets and low-rise hotels date from that boom, giving the town a neat, purpose-built marina feel rather than ancient charm. Today it’s a year-round base for blue-cruise charters and gulet tourism, with a calm, moneyed atmosphere and few historical sights.

Best Time to Visit

Full Mugla guide →

Best months

May, September and October: sea is warm enough to swim, air temperatures sit in the low 30s °C (high 80s °F), and the main summer crowds haven't arrived or have already left. Days are long and sunny, with a reliable meltemi breeze.

Peak / festival surge

July and August: temperatures hit 35–40 °C, the marina is packed with gulets and day-trippers from Fethiye and Dalaman. Hotel prices double or triple; the Göcek Festival (usually late July) draws extra crowds with concerts and yacht parades.

Budget shoulder season

April and mid-October: rooms cost 30–50% less, the weather is still pleasant (22–28 °C), and you can walk the harbour without dodging selfie-sticks. Some restaurants and boat tours may only run at weekends outside high season.

Weather & packing

Göcek gets a quirky, sudden afternoon breeze called the meltemi that can turn a calm sea choppy within minutes — always bring a light windproof jacket even in July. Pack UV-protective sun shirt and reef-safe sunscreen; the sun here is fierce by 10 a.m. even in summer.

Money & Currency

Get a travel card →
💵
Local currency

Turkish Lira, TRY

🏦
Where to exchange

Use ATMs in town for the best rates; avoid airport and tourist-area exchange bureaux which give poor rates.

💳
Cards & contactless

Credit/debit cards are widely accepted in restaurants, hotels, and larger shops; smaller places and markets prefer cash.

🪙
Tipping etiquette

Round up the bill or leave 5-10% in restaurants; tip taxi drivers by rounding up; hotel staff appreciate small gratuities in cash.

About Mugla

Wikipedia ↗
Mugla, Turkey — city travel guide

Muğla (Turkish: [ˈmuːɫa]) is a city in southwestern Turkey. The city is the center of the district of Menteşe and Muğla Province, which stretches along Turkey's Aegean coast.
